Leopard on the loose!

Wednesday 11 February 2015

"Tama zoo is on red alert. More than 50 zookeepers, backed up by police and emergency services, are mobilised to contain a terrible threat. A snow leopard has escaped from the Tokyo wildlife park, and must be stopped before it devours a child. Except the children on site are clearly having a great time," writes AFP's Antoine Bouthier. "Unlike the grown-ups who are taking this all very seriously, it’s obvious to them the runaway feline is a zoo employee in a cute costume. Think Pokemon meets Hello Kitty."
